In Western biology, there is a theory of the "Red Queen".
The meaning of this theory is that in the evolution of the biological world, all living things must constantly compete with other species around them, and once evolution is stopped, then this species will be eliminated without mercy.
The whole evolutionary process can be described by the phrase "if you don't advance against the current, you will retreat", and the crooked nuts don't know this sentence, but in the story of "Alice in Wonderland", the Red Queen said this to Alice: "In this world, you have to keep running to keep yourself in place." ”
So, scientists named this the Red Queen Theory.

In the 90s of the last century, biological sequencing technology has been relatively mature, and scientists began to study the nucleotide sequences in human chromosomes to decipher the secrets in the human genetic code.
Researchers have found that about 8% of the structures in the human genome are confirmed to be made up of viruses that once attacked our ancestors, and 40%-50% of the structures are suspected to be made up of viruses that invaded our ancestors.
To put it simply, a virus is like a robot composed mainly of nucleic acids, and when attacking humans, it will embed itself into the nucleotide chain of human cells like a parasite, and then secretly disassemble the nucleic acids of the cells to make the same appearance as itself, so as to replicate a large number of itself.
However, when replicating, it is easy to leave a part of itself in the human DNA chain, such as the production of the placenta, which is the result of a viral infection, which can synthesize syncytin, and mammals are infected with this virus before it becomes viviparous.
These viruses are called "endogenous retroviruses", and some of them are even the most important enemies in human history, but they have become an indispensable part of human evolution to this day.
